DANGER
•Dangerous voltages are present when power is supplied to the fixture.
•This fixture has more than one power supply. Disconnect lamp power supply
before installation or removal of the lamp.
•Ensure lamp power supply matches lamp manufactures specification.
•Always stand clear of fixture during ignition cycle.
•Ensure fixture meets all local codes prior to operation.
•Safe electrical and working practices must be observed.
WARNING
•This fixture has rotating parts with pinch points.
•Fixtures may move without warning.
•No personal within range of motion.
•Never operate fixture with any covers missing.
•Fixture cooling fans may start automatically, without warning.
WARNING
HEAT AND ULTRAVIOLET RADIATION!
•Arc lamps generate broad spectrum UV radiation.
•Do not operate without complete lamp enclosure in place.
•Do not operate if the UV lens is damaged or missing.
•Limit exposure to high density light.
•UV blocking suntan lotion should be used when working in high density light
locations.
•Excessive exposure to high intensity white light may cause fatigue and skin
irritation.
•High energy light output will burn skin and ignite combustible materials. Do
not operate in the proximity of materials that are adversely affected by heat or
light.
•Failure to adhere to these warnings may result in serious burns or irreversible
skin/eye damage.
•Do not look directly into the light during operation.

Hand Controller
When the LRX fixture in FIXTURE mode, pins 4 & 5 on the DMX
IN connector become energized to 12VDC to supply power to the hand
controller. No power is supplied to pins 4 & 5 when in DMX mode.

Fixture Specifications
Electrical: Note this fixture has multiple power sources.
Control power:
•Battery (for programing and parking)
•90-250 AC – non-dimmed feed line 50/60 Hertz
•Watts: 250W
•Power from Lamp Supply
Metal Halide Lamps:
•6KWSE with extended 38mm base (Wolfram)
•6KSE standard 38mm base requires a socket extender part number - G38-
6X, will be required to compensate for the shorter L.C.L. of the standard
6KSE lamp.
•12KWSE with a 38mm base
•18KWSE with a 38 or 51mm base.IMPORTANT NOTE: Lamps must have
an overall length of 470mm or less. Confirm fit with the lamp in place and
fixture set to the flood position, carefully close the lens door checking for
lamp clearance on the UV lens. Osram lamps are 495mm and do not fit.
Tungsten Lamps:
•10KWSE with a 38mm base
•12KWSE with a 38mm base
Head Input Connector:
•Input is configured to accept the Arri type 12/18K connector.
•LRX fixture connector: Cannon part# CB0-28A16PS-A232
•Tungsten mode requires LRX Tungsten input connector with tails that
mate to local distribution.
a. Pin “C” = Line
b. Pin “H” = Neutral
c. Pin “B” = Ground
•See wiring diagram for all pin out connections.
Data Cable:
•Five pin XLR connector

Physical
•Tilt: 40 degrees above horizontal to 90 degrees below horizontal
•Pan: 330 degrees
•Weight: 57kg/125 pounds approx.
•Designed to accept 29” diameter filter frames, scrims & etc.
•Fixture mounting hooks have been designed to mate with truss chords not
greater than two inches (50.8mm) in diameter.

Handling the Fixture
•Opening the shipping case cover requires two people to lift. Always use
handles to avoid potential pinch points.
•Heavy lift, minimum two persons, the fixture weight is approximately
57kg/125 pounds.
•Hanging of the fixture creates several potential pinch points.
•Use fixture lifting points, two handles as well as the yoke housing near the tilt
bearing housing are used for lifting.
•If there are any concerns regarding handling, please contact your supervisor.
•Ensure hanger bolts are installed immediately after hanging the fixture.
•Ratchet straps must always have a minimum of one and a half wraps around
the ratchet drum.
